Check out the live streaming details for India vs Thailand FIFA International Friendly to be played at the Thammasat Stadium in Rangsit.
Thammasat Stadium in Rangsit Live Football Streaming For the FIFA International Friendly Match: The Indian national football team take on Thailand in a FIFA International friendly match on Wednesday, June 4, at the Thammasat Stadium in Rangsit. The Blue Tigers travel to Thailand after finishing off an extensive domestic training session. The upcoming face-off provides them a great opportunity to prepare for the AFC Asian Cup 2027 qualifier against Hong Kong later this month.
While ranked 127th in the world, India has been on a gradual rise under experienced coach Manolo Marquez, enjoying a five-game unbeaten streak. But the wins haven't been easy to come by. The Blue Tigers' previous match was a goalless draw against Bangladesh. Their most recent victory – a 3-0 triumph over Maldives in March – came after 489 days.
Thailand have also faced a mixed bag of results this year despite boasting of a strong squad on paper. The War Elephants enjoyed a 2-0 win over Afghanistan in a friendly before going on to beat Sri Lanka 1-0 in their last outing. But the conclusion of their ASEAN Championship campaign would continue to sting Thailand players as they lost both the finals to Vietnam after enjoying a fantastic run in the previous stages of the competition.

The ICC rankings published on Wednesday created a flutter around the cricket world as the ODI list did not have the names of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ma. Both the Indian cricket superstars have retired from Tests and T20Is. ODI is the only format that they are still active. In the midst of this, Kohli and Rohit's missing names started a speculation on social media that they might be on their way out from the ODI format too. However ICC has now clarified that it was a technical glitch that saw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ma's named missing from the ICC list. "A number of issues in this week's rankings are currently being investigated," the ICC told Wisden. Later, both the names were added. Rohit is currently ranked No. 2 while Kohli is no. 4. Meanwhile, India wrist spinner Kuldeep Yadav has slipped to third place in the latest ICC ODI rankings for bowlers released on Wednesday with South African tweaker Kehsav Maharaj reclaiming the top position. Maharaj regained the top position after helping his team beat Australia by 98 runs in the first ODI of their three-match series in Cairns. The 35-year-old left-arm spinner, who was named Player of the Match after grabbing five for 33, overtook Kuldeep and Sri Lanka's Maheesh Theekshana to the top spot, which he had earlier held briefly in November and December 2023. Apart from Kuldeep, Ravindra Jadeja is the only Indian bowler who is in the top 10 in the updated list. The Indian team has not played an ODI match since their title triumph in the Champions Trophy. West Indies fast bowler Jayden Seales was another one to make huge inroads in the bowling rankings after his superb haul of six for 18 in the final game of their three-match series against Pakistan, moving up 15 spots to 18th position. Pakistan leg-spinner Abrar Ahmed (up 15 places to joint-39th) and West Indies off-spinner Roston Chase (up five places to 58th) are others to move up the list.

Indian chess icon Viswanathan Anand is set to renew his legendary rivalry with Russian great Garry Kasparov, while reigning world champion D Gukesh will face Magnus Carlsen in the Clutch Chess exhibition matches this October in St Louis, headline fixture will see Anand and Kasparov, two of the game's greatest ever players, lock horns once again from October 7 to 11. The pair last met competitively at the 2001 Croatia Rapid and Blitz in Zagreb, where Kasparov came out on top. Over their illustrious careers, they have faced each other 82 times across different formats, with the Russian legend holding the upper hand in head-to-head former world champions, Garry Kasparov and Viswanathan Anand, go head-to-head in a special Clutch Chess (Legends) exhibition match. This once-in-a-generation clash celebrates the legacy of two chess greats and officially launches the month of reopening festivities,' the St Louis Chess Club said in a statement. The duel will also mark the first event at the club's newly enhanced facility, reaffirming St Louis's status as the chess capital of the United States and a global hub for the the legends, some of the biggest modern stars will also feature, making this one of the most high-profile tournaments of the year. The lineup includes American stars Hikaru Nakamura and Fabiano Caruana, both top-10 players, ensuring the event is one of the highest-rated competitions on the to the excitement, the tournament will adopt a unique format that rewards consistency and late surges. The 18-game rapid double round-robin (10 minutes plus a 5-second increment) will feature escalating point values across three days. Wins will be worth one point on Day 1, two points on Day 2, and three points on Day a massive prize pool of USD 412,000 — including daily win bonuses and a Champion's Jackpot — the stakes are higher than ever.
